Booking Your Session: Timing Is Everything
To achieve the beautiful, glowing light you see in our images, timing matters. Here’s a guide to help you choose the ideal outdoor session window based on the season:
• Spring: 3:00 PM – 6:00 PM
• Summer: 6:00 PM – 8:00PM
• Fall: 4:00 PM – 6:00 PM
• Winter: 2:00 PM – 4:00 PM
These time frames are based on when natural light is at its most flattering. When booking your session on our website, please be sure to select a time within these windows. We’ll take care of finding the perfect location!
Indoor Sessions & Natural Light
We do not use artificial studio lighting—not because we don’t know how, but because we choose to work exclusively with natural light to preserve the soft, organic aesthetic we’re known for.
Indoor sessions can be scheduled during the following windows:
• Spring & Summer: 8:00 AM – 4:00 PM
• Fall & Winter: 9:00 AM – 2:00 PM
On rainy or overly dark days, we generally recommend rescheduling. The exception is newborn sessions—baby-only (no siblings or parents). These can still be done indoors.
What to Wear: Creating Timeless, Beautiful Imagery
When you look at an image & it looks so delicious,
it’s because the vibe is there, the clothes are on point
and the lighting is the bitter warmth of golden beauty.
Our editing thrives on natural light and earthy, neutral tones.
While you’re welcome to wear what you love,
we highly recommend sticking to warm,
muted, and creamy colors.
These tones not only reduce distractions in the image
but also create a timeless aesthetic and help us maintain a consistent editing flow
—which can speed up your gallery delivery, too!
We’ll also have provided a year-round style and color palette reference (below) to help coordinate outfits for everyone in your session.
Remember: It’s a guide, not a requirement—but a little wardrobe planning goes a long way!
